Learn more about Maidenhead

Riverside walks along the Thames offer picturesque views of Maidenhead Bridge and Boulters Lock with its charming island. Explore Maidenhead Heritage Centre to discover local history or catch performances at the historic Norden Farm Centre for the Arts.

  • Windsor: Nestled approximately 8.0km from Maidenhead, Windsor is a historic city renowned for its royal connections. Visitors flock to this charming destination year-round, with peak seasons in April to May and July. Windsor offers a delightful blend of family-friendly activities, cultural experiences, and outdoor adventures. Explore the iconic Windsor Castle, one of the oldest and largest occupied castles in the world. The city also features an amusement park, a vibrant shopping area, and scenic golf courses, perfect for a fun-filled day out.

Things to do near Maidenhead

Shopping

In Maidenhead, you can enjoy the convenience of the Nicholson Centre, featuring a mix of high street brands and local shops. If you're up for a drive, visit the Oracle in Reading, about 24.1km away, which offers a vibrant shopping experience with a variety of retail outlets and eateries.

Recreation

In Maidenhead, the Crowne Plaza's Spa offers rejuvenating treatments and a serene atmosphere, ideal for unwinding. Nearby, the Maidenhead Aquatics centre features a relaxing swimming pool and fitness classes, providing a refreshing way to stay active during your visit.

Adventure

Experience the thrill of motorsport at Mercedes-Benz World, located 25.7km from Maidenhead, where you can immerse yourself in high-speed driving and racing vibes. Alternatively, navigate the treetops at Go Ape in Bracknell, 14.5km away, or tackle another zipline challenge at Go Ape in Wendover Woods, 29.0km distant.

Nightlife

Experience the lively nightlife of Maidenhead at The Buttermarket, where you can dance the night away. For a relaxed vibe, visit The Old Bell pub for a pint and friendly chatter. If you fancy cocktails, try The Railway Bell, known for its creative drinks and welcoming atmosphere.

  • Cliveden House: This historic house offers a glimpse into opulent living, surrounded by stunning gardens and parkland. With its rich heritage and elegant architecture, visitors can enjoy afternoon tea or explore the artistic interiors that echo centuries of history.
  • Windsor Castle: Located 9.7km from Maidenhead, Windsor Castle is a magnificent royal residence steeped in culture and romance. Marvel at the grand State Apartments and St. George's Chapel, and stroll through the picturesque grounds that have inspired many stories of British royalty.
  • National Trust Cliveden: This eco-friendly plantation invites you to immerse yourself in nature. Wander through beautiful woodlands and gardens, perfect for leisurely walks and wildlife spotting, making it a serene escape within Maidenhead.

Best time to go to Maidenhead

The best time to visit Maidenhead is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January39.9°F (4.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February41.0°F (5.0°C)No R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March44.2°F (6.8°C)No R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April48.6°F (9.2°C)No R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
May54.0°F (12.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June60.1°F (15.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
July63.9°F (17.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
August63.1°F (17.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
September59.2°F (15.1°C)No R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
October53.4°F (11.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
November46.4°F (8.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
December42.3°F (5.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age

What is the best area to stay in Maidenhead?
The best area to stay in Maidenhead is the town centre, particularly around the High Street and the waterways.This area offers the most convenience for visitors, with a good selection of shops, restaurants, and local amenities. The High Street is the main commercial thoroughfare, and the nearby waterways, including the River Thames and the Maidenhead Waterways, provide pleasant walking opportunities. You'll find many of the town's key services and transport links concentrated here.For couples looking for a relaxing break with easy access to dining and riverside strolls, the town centre is ideal. You can enjoy meals at various restaurants and then take a walk along the revitalised waterways or even catch a boat trip on the Thames. The area's central location also makes it easy to explore nearby attractions.Business travellers will also find the town centre highly convenient. Its proximity to the main train station offers quick connections to London Paddington and Reading, and many of the town's business HQs are within easy reach.

When is the best time to go to Maidenhead?
The best time to visit Maidenhead is generally during the spring (April to June) and autumn (September to October) months.These periods offer pleasant weather, making it ideal for exploring the town and surrounding countryside without the extremes of summer heat or winter chill. You'll find the gardens and riverside walks particularly enjoyable, and the local events calendar often features outdoor activities. It's a great time for couples to enjoy scenic walks along the Thames Path or visit historical sites like Cliveden House.Mid-summer (July and August) can also be a good time, especially if you're keen on watersports on the Thames or attending outdoor festivals. However, it can be busier and hotel prices might be slightly higher due to school holidays. Families often find the summer months convenient for visiting attractions like the Norden Farm Centre for the Arts, which often has family-friendly programming.
